• Country: USA
  • State: Louisiana
  • City: Shreveport
  • Address: 2800 W 70th St A, Shreveport, LA 71108, USA
Phone number
More companies in your city
Rapid Roofing & Repair

Shreveport, LA 71107, USA

Renew Softwash of North La

Shreveport, LA 71118, USA

Focus On Family Living Home

Shreveport, LA 71101, USA

All Weather Roofing

228 Aero Dr, Shreveport, LA 71107, USA

Added comment